Approaches and Support for Online Therapy

Alexander commonly draws on Client-Centered Therapy,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) in his work. Client-Centered Therapy emphasizes a respectful, nonjudgmental relationship where the client’s priorities shape the direction of sessions, helping with self-exploration and relationship or identity concerns. CBT focuses on identifying and changing unhelpful thinking and behavior patterns, which can be effective for stress, anxiety, depression, and many day-to-day difficulties. DBT teaches emotion regulation, distress tolerance, and interpersonal effectiveness skills, which are useful for intense emotions, relationship conflicts, and challenges with impulsivity.

Choosing the right approach is a collaborative process. Alexander works with clients to clarify goals, preferences, and what feels most helpful, then adapts techniques from these approaches to fit each person’s needs and pace. This collaborative planning helps ensure therapy aligns with practical goals and values.
